Output d77b8c5e2741d0d0a6604d09a795b3e612914f3043b1502f52bcc042eb7b7da9:44

value
695785653
script pubkey
OP_0 OP_PUSHBYTES_20 ebf590b1603ce706c3aa5f51dd89f4f6a36c34f1
address
bc1qa06epvtq8nnsdsa2tagamz05763kcd836ek5er
transaction
d77b8c5e2741d0d0a6604d09a795b3e612914f3043b1502f52bcc042eb7b7da9
spent
true